## Session handling — Pathreed field-survey app, offline mode

For the security review: when a surveyor goes offline, Pathreed caches an encrypted session envelope locally rather than the raw session cookie. On reconnect, the envelope is exchanged for a fresh session, and the cached copy is wiped. Envelopes expire after 72 hours regardless of activity. To test the exchange endpoint in the review sandbox, authenticate with the token below.

session JWT of yawep-yawep = eyJhbGciOiJIUzI1NiIsInR5cCI6IkpXVCJ9.eyJzdWIiOiI3pWF3_In0.aXYsHiog

# EchoDocent Environments

The EchoDocent audio-guide platform for the Marivell Museum runs three environments: sandbox, staging, and production. Plugin authors should develop exclusively against sandbox, which mirrors production behaviour but serves placeholder exhibit audio. Staging is reserved for the internal curation team, and requests from unregistered plugins are rejected there. Rate limits are identical across all three tiers. Your plugin should load the following configuration values at startup.

deployment values, kajef-fahip:
druwyn:
  pin: 0722
  metrics_host: metrics.druwyn.zemvarsys.internal
  tenant: juldor
  seal: seal_6ddf1794

Action item: The Relayn deploy-status bot silently dropped updates when the pipeline API paginated results, so responders believed a rollback had completed when it had not. We will add pagination handling, a staleness banner, and an integration test. Until merged, verify deploy state directly in the pipeline console, documented at the page below.

runbook for kahop-kajop: https://rundeck.ordinio.test/display/secrets/pipeline/issue/pages/repo/browse/e5732776e07d1285107e5aeb